Within the framework of the Erasmus program, the Law School of Neapolis University in Cyprus has organized specialized lectures on comparative criminal law with the participation of two distinguished visiting professors from the Czech Republic (12 -16 October 2014). Criminal Law Professors Dr. Vera Kalvodova and Dr. Marek Frystak, from the Law School of the Masaryk University (Czech Republic) gave a series of lectures on a wide range of intriguing topics, such as criminal proceedings, economic crime and the prison system.
The lectures were attended by the academic staff and the students of the Law School, who actively participated in the discussions that followed. The academic visit and the lectures were organized with the valuable assistance of the Erasmus Office of our University and the teaching staff of the Law School (G. Pavlidis and A. Savvidou).
